CONDITION OF .FEDERAL m;SERVE BANKS

The consolidated statement of condition of the Federal :reso:rve banks on October
15, made public by the Federal Reserve Board, shows further·increRSe s of $21,900, OCO
in holdings of acceptances purchased in open market and of $17, 300;000 in Go•1ernment
securities, together with a net liquidation of $3,300,000 in hold.ings of discounted
bills. As a result of these changes total earning assets rose to $i,060,900.000, or
$36,100,000 above the amount held a week ago, Federal res!':rve note circulation increased by $9,800,000 and total deposits by $2~ 700,000, while cash reserves declined
by $11,000,000.

The New York reserve bank reports a reduction of $9,600,000 in its holdings of
discounted bills, Dallas a r~ducticn of $1,700,000, while the Cleveland and Richmond
banks report additions of $6,600,000 and $1,)300,000 :r-:espt.Jctively to theirholdings.
The remaining banks show relatively smaller thanges in holdings of discounted bills
f~r the week.
Ho).dings of paper secured by Governmdl t obligations declin-:d by
$6001 000 t 0 $109 19001 000.
Larger holdings of acceptances purchased in open market were reported by all
Federal reserve banks except Richmond and M:in:r:Eapolis, the Ftoderal ~eserve bank. of
New York showing an increase of $9,600)000, Boston an increase of $6,100,000 ard
Philadelphia an increase of $2,100,000. The System•s holdings of U. s. C,;;lrtificat.as
of inclebtedness increased by $13,700,000, of Treasury notes by $3,000,000, anl of
U. s. bonds by $6Qo;;ooo. A total increase of $16,ooo,ooo in Government security
holdings is shown for the Federal Reserve Bank of New York.
All Federal reserve banks report a larger volume of Fed0ral rl3serve notes in
circulation, except New York, which shows a decline of $2,000,000. Th..; Philadelphia
bank reports the largest increase - $3,400,QOO, Boston shows an increase of
$3,200,000, and Richmond of $1,900,000. Gold reserves d~clined by $~,600,000 during
the week, ~eserves other than gold by $2,300,000 and Nan-resGrve cash by $3,500,000~
